Karaula Kruška
Karaula Kruška is a border post in Knjaževac, Zaječar District, Central Serbia and has an elevation of 1,280 metres. Karaula Kruška is situated nearby to the village Aldinac, as well as near Radičevac.Places in the Area

Aldinac
Village
Aldinac is a village in the municipality of Knjaževac, Serbia. According to the 2002 census, the village has a population of 26 people. Aldinac is situated 5 km southwest of Karaula Kruška.
Radičevac
Village
Radičevac is a village in the municipality of Knjaževac, Serbia. According to the 2002 census, the village has a population of 59 people. Radičevac is situated 6 km northwest of Karaula Kruška.
